Boat on the Road! Madhya Pradesh Streets Turn into Streams as Mandakini River Overflows
Boat on the Road! Madhya Pradesh Streets Turn into Streams as Mandakini River Overflows

Flooded roads, stranded vehicles, and boats floating where buses usually pass this was the scene in parts of Madhya Pradesh after the Mandakini River overflowed due to relentless rainfall. In Chhatarpur district, particularly around Lanka Chowk and Janaki Ghat, heavy downpours transformed roads into mini-rivers, leading to chaotic disruptions and dramatic visuals.

In one video that went viral, a small boat was seen paddling down a submerged road a surreal symbol of the impact monsoon fury can bring. Locals, caught between astonishment and concern, said, “It feels like the road turned into a stream overnight.”

With streets waist-deep in water, residents struggled to commute, wade through currents, and protect their homes and shops. Public transportation was paralyzed, and many roads were declared unsafe. Several low-lying areas had already begun evacuation, and emergency relief camps were set up for displaced families.

The local administration jumped into action, issuing advisories and deploying disaster response teams. Water pumps were installed to drain the floodwater, and barricades were placed in highly affected zones to prevent accidents.

Officials from the Meteorological Department warned that rainfall may continue intermittently, urging citizens to stay indoors unless absolutely necessary. The Mandakini’s water level remains high, and more rainfall could worsen the already dire situation.
